Who stole the bridge?
Today’s schedule called for a 5 mile run but I decided that I was feeling good and decided to do my harbour loop run which is about 11km. Conditions were perfect at the start. It’s one of those glorious spring days here in Auckland today. However, by the time I got down to the harbour area I was running into a huge fog bank. The bridge had all but disappeared:
By the time I got to the CBD the fog had burnt off and could only be seen in the distance:
It was quite a cool experience (figuratively and literally!) and I really enjoyed it.
The run itself was fantastic. I just felt good the whole way and it’s probably the fastest run I’ve done since my last race.
Overall 11.04 km in 1:01:28 which I’m quite happy with. So far in September I’ve averaged 10K a day.
Gotta love the marathon training.
